Gabapentin and Blood Pressure Connection

Understanding the link between gabapentin and blood pressure starts with acknowledging the complex interactions within the body. While gabapentin does not contain direct vasodilatory properties that would typically lower blood pressure, its use in chronic pain management can indirectly influence blood pressure levels. Pain management is crucial as chronic pain often leads to increased stress and anxiety, contributing to elevated blood pressure levels. Thus, relieving pain can help bring stability back to blood pressure.

Clinical studies have shown varying results. Some patients report fluctuations in blood pressure after initiating gabapentin therapy, which may be due to underlying health conditions rather than the medication itself. Monitoring is key, especially for patients on other medications that impact blood pressure.

Effects of Pain on Blood Pressure

Chronic pain can significantly affect blood pressure levels. Pain stimulates the sympathetic nervous system, leading to increased heart rate and blood pressure. Similarly, this can create a cycle in which elevated blood pressure may amplify the perception of pain. Thus, effective management of chronic pain ailments with medications like gabapentin could create a stabilizing effect on blood pressure. Several studies suggest that when pain is effectively managed, patients may experience a decrease in blood pressure fluctuations, leading to improved overall cardiovascular health.

Gabapentin’s Side Effects

Like any medication, gabapentin has potential side effects. Common effects include dizziness, sedation, and fatigue, which could lead to changes in physical activity and lifestyle. Physical activity is a key component in maintaining stable blood pressure levels; thus, restrictions due to side effects may inadvertently affect blood pressure. Patients should be aware and communicate any unsettling side effects to their healthcare provider to ensure a comprehensive approach to managing their health.

Monitoring Blood Pressure While Taking Gabapentin

For individuals using gabapentin, regular monitoring of blood pressure is advisable, particularly within the first few weeks of treatment. Adjustments in blood pressure may occur, depending on an individual’s response to the medication and existing health conditions. Patients with a history of hypertension or those taking additional medications that influence blood pressure should pay even greater attention to their readings. Keeping a log of blood pressure can help healthcare providers assess any significant changes and adjust treatment methods accordingly.

Frequently Asked Questions

1. Can gabapentin raise blood pressure?
Gabapentin itself is not known to raise blood pressure directly. However, chronic pain and stress associated with it can influence blood pressure, which may change with gabapentin treatment.

2. Should I monitor my blood pressure while taking gabapentin?
Yes, especially if you have a history of hypertension. Regular monitoring allows for adjustments in treatment if needed.

3. Can gabapentin cause dizziness or sedation affecting blood pressure?
Yes, these side effects may limit physical activity and affect cardiovascular health, hence indirectly influencing blood pressure.

4. What should I do if I notice changes in my blood pressure while on gabapentin?
Consult your healthcare provider immediately to assess the situation and possibly adjust your treatment plan.

5. Are there alternatives to gabapentin for pain management that are safer for blood pressure?
Yes, non-medication approaches like physical therapy, acupuncture, and lifestyle changes can help manage pain without impacting blood pressure significantly.
